Forward-Thinking Legal Guidance: District Board Governance & Shared Governance

In administration and governance, we are seasoned advisors, having dealt with countless politically charged situations and topics at board and committee meetings. Our deep expertise extends to conflicts of interest rooted in Government Code section 1090, the Political Reform Act, or common law. We are not just advisors but educators imparting wisdom on various conflict-related topics. And we navigate the terrain with finesse regarding electoral shifts, from at-large to district or odd-year to even-year. We have advised hundreds of educational institutions on compliance with the Brown Act’s requirements, from agenda descriptions to what can be discussed in closed sessions to new teleconferencing requirements.  We respond to Public Records Act requests and abet educational institutions with complex legal issues surrounding the disclosure of employee and student records.  Our knowledge is not just about processes and compliance – our experience gives us a unique perspective on the role that Boards and administrations can and should play in driving student retention and success.
